The European electronics manufacturing sector is undergoing a massive transformation, heavily driven by the rapid shift toward automotive electrification and sophisticated industrial automation. At the heart of this technological evolution is the humble yet critical component: the multilayer ceramic capacitor (MLCC). As European automakers aggressively expand their electric vehicle (EV) lineups and factories integrate advanced robotics, the demand for highly reliable, stable, and durable electronic components has skyrocketed.

In modern automotive design, EVs and hybrid vehicles require a vast number of electronic control units (ECUs), adv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S), and powertrain electrification technologies. Traditional capacitors often fall short under the harsh operating conditions found under the hood of a vehicle. Consequently, the industry is increasingly turning to specialized, high-voltage MLCCs utilizing advanced surface-mount technology (SMT). These components are engineered to withstand extreme temperature fluctuations, mechanical vibrations, and high electric currents, ensuring the absolute safety and functional longevity of critical automotive applications.

Simultaneously, the push for Industry 4.0 across manufacturing hubs in Germany, France, and Italy is accelerating the adoption of industrial automation. Smart factories rely on a web of interconnected sensors, programmable logic controllers (PLCs), and high-speed communication modules. Each of these devices requires precise power decoupling and noise filtering to prevent signal degradation and system failures. The Europe Multilayer Ceramic Capacitor Market is expanding rapidly to meet these stringent industrial requirements, providing the structural foundations necessary for seamless, automated operations.

Furthermore, compliance with strict European environmental and safety regulations, such as RoHS and REACH, is reshaping how these passive components are manufactured. Leading component manufacturers are investing heavily in eco-friendly material formulations and advanced ceramic dielectrics that offer higher capacitance density without sacrificing stability. As European industrial ecosystems become cleaner and more digitally integrated, the reliance on high-performance multilayer ceramic capacitors will only continue to intensify, cementing their role as an indispensable pillar of modern European engineering.
